It’s been a decade ago where the Original Pilipino Music (OPM) rocked the entire Philippine music scene, considering the fact that US mainstream (or let’s say foreign, in general) always been the standout among the local music charts.

Yes, the local music scene dominated 2004 wherein the likes of Usher (Yeah, My Boo, Burn), Nelly (My Place), Alicia Keys (If I Ain’t Got You), and even the alternative rock acts such as Maroon 5 (She Will Be Loved), 3 Doors Down (Here Without You) and Hoobastank (The Reason) were household names in Billboard.

I remember printing out pages from those music countdowns of Magic 89.9, 97.1 Campus Radio LS FM and even 99.5 RT, seeing one song in common: Rainbow by South Border.

Michael Jackson's death instantly abrupt plans of making a huge comeback to the music scene via his worldwide tour This is It. And supposedly, it will have their kickstart on the O2 Arena in London on July 13 2009, just few weeks before his untimely demise on June 25.

Isang malaking piyesa sa kasaysayan ng college basketball ang pagsunkit muli ng kameponato ng National University Bulldogs sa UAAP noong nakaraang Miyerkules. Isang historic na underdog victory, ika nga (kahit ang bulldog ay pang-siga) dahil matapos maolats sa Game 1, ay binawian nila ang kalabang Far Easter University Tamaraws sa Games 2 at 3.

Isang rally sa third quarter ang nagkita ng panalo para sa mga taga-Jhocson, 75-59, para kunin ang kanilang ikalawang titulo sa UAAP sa kasaysayan ng pagsali nito. Pareho silang mga orihinal na miyembro ng naturang liga mula noong naitatag ito noong 1930s.

Is racism very rampant in every aspect of our daily lives? Yes, and it even applies on the world of sports-entertainment. Perhaps, you can blame office (or in this case, backstage) politics on this.

Just a few months ago, the world was shocked in disbelief when the national Basketball Association (NBA) was put into the spotlight after raging discriminatory remarks from the Los Angeles Clippers’ ex-owner Donald Sterling, which led to his eventual ousting from his team of three decades.

WWE.com
Then there comes Alberto Del Rio’s firing from the World Wrestling Entertainment (WWE). Several combat sports beat outlet reports that Del Rio, or Alberto Rodriguez in real life, was ousted by the Connecticut-based promotion for being an “unsportsmanlike conduct to an employee.”
